Solar Panel Modern Technology Basics



To truly realize the essence of solar panel innovation, you have to explore the basic principles that underpin its functionality. Photovoltaic panel consist of solar batteries, normally made from silicon, which have the impressive capacity to convert sunshine right into electricity via the photovoltaic effect. When sunshine hits the cells, the photons in the light interact with the silicon atoms, triggering the electrons to break free from their atomic bonds. This creates an electric current that can then be taken advantage of for powering different tools.



The crucial element of photovoltaic panels is the semiconductors within the solar batteries, which promote the conversion of sunshine right into useful electrical power. These semiconductors have both positive and unfavorable layers, developing an electrical area that enables the circulation of electrons.

This flow of electrons, when linked in a circuit, generates straight current (DC) electrical power. Recognizing these standard concepts is critical for valuing just how solar panels can harness the sun's power to power homes, organizations, and even satellites in space.

Exactly How Solar Panels Generate Power



Solar panels harness the sun's energy by transforming sunlight right into electrical energy through a procedure called the solar impact. When solar panels in residential buildings hits the photovoltaic panels, the photons (light particles) are taken in by the semiconducting materials within the panels, typically made from silicon. This absorption produces an electric present as the photons knock electrons loosened from the atoms within the product.

The electric areas within the solar batteries then require these electrons to flow in a specific direction, developing a straight current (DC) of electrical power. This direct current is after that passed through an inverter, which transforms it right into rotating present (AC) power that can be utilized to power your home or service.

Excess electrical power generated by the photovoltaic panels can be kept in batteries for later use or fed back right into the grid for credit report through a procedure called internet metering. Recognizing Photovoltaic Panel Parts



One crucial aspect of solar panel technology is comprehending the numerous parts that compose a photovoltaic panel system.

The vital elements of a photovoltaic panel system include the photovoltaic panels themselves, which are made up of photovoltaic cells that transform sunlight into power. These panels are mounted on a framework, often a roof, to capture sunlight.

In addition to the panels, there are inverters that convert the direct current (DC) electrical power produced by the panels right into rotating current (AIR CONDITIONER) electricity that can be used in homes or services.

The system additionally includes racking to sustain and place the solar panels for optimal sunlight direct exposure. Furthermore, cables and adapters are vital for delivering the power produced by the panels to the electrical system of a structure.

Last but not least, a surveillance system might be consisted of to track the performance of the solar panel system and ensure it's functioning successfully. Recognizing these components is crucial for any person looking to set up or utilize photovoltaic panel modern technology properly.
